The Global Merchant & Network Services (GM&NS) Pricing Group at arenaflex is responsible for driving revenue growth through customer-centric pricing principles, flexible pricing architectures, and innovative pricing solutions. Our team works closely with various business partners to determine the best rates that encourage merchants to accept arenaflex while improving service and merchant satisfaction. As a Planning and Analysis in Canada Financial Analyst, you'll play a critical role in forecasting and reporting company revenues, providing a unique opportunity to influence business decisions and drive growth. You'll work closely with cross-functional teams to analyze data, identify trends, and develop insights that inform business strategies.
